I have four cats. In order of when they moved in, they are:

Clyde and Charlotte - I got them when I was living in Vancouver in 2002. The woman who lived in the townhouse next to where I worked got evicted and left many of her pets behind. We never got the actual numbers because we couldn't catch them all - but both cats and dogs in her house were up in the double-digits. They were both around 2.5-3 months old, so I took them both and a friend of mine took their mother. I wasn't in a position to take on an adult at that time because I still had Mo at that time (he has since passed away) who was also a rescue and was aggressive with other adult cats, but I knew him to be friendly with kittens (for some reason.)

Clyde is gigantic, weighing in at nearly 20 pounds. He's not FAT however, he's just huge. I have never seen such large feet on a cat, and he is incredibly long. He chirps rather than meows, so I suspect that he is part Maine Coon. He is VERY talkative and a real lover - seriously. He loves love.

Charlotte is a diva. She has a naturally snotty voice (for a cat) and if you pet her she will often groom the area that you had pet afterward - I think she thinks I am dirty. She ignores me all day, but once I am in bed she asks to snuggle. She likes to be held like a teddy bear until I fall asleep.

Eliot is the only cat I have ever had who wasn't rescued from somewhere. A friend of mine (who lived in Michigan at that time) had a cat who had kittens and she posted the pictures on facebook - it was all over from there. I MADE Nick take me to Michigan to pick Eliot up once he was old enough. He is Clyde's best friend, and still (although he is nearly 3 years old now) tries to nurse on Clyde's belly. He likes foil balls, is very tolerant of my desire to put hats on him, and usually lays across my lap when I am on the computer.

Elphaba is just over 3 years old and has been with me for 2 years now. The woman who used to have her had a nasty habit of going out of town for WEEKS at a time and leaving Elphaba locked out on the balcony. It was summertime and hot and she had no food and water (aside from the food and water I would climb up on a chair to give to her) and there was so much feces on that balcony that you could smell it from quite a distance away. One night I decided that feeding her wasn't good enough - so I got up on the balcony and "stole" her. She was really thin and scared and sickly, so I got her to the vet and got her healthy and kept her. She is still not quite over her "I don't know when I will be fed next" impulse and breaks into my garbage can on occasion - but I forgive her. She's very friendly and no matter what I am doing or where in the apartment I am, she is always right by my side.

In as much as its gonna make ppl cringe, all our pups favor cheap stuff. Store brand of the "Kibbles & Bits".

Max will pick thru and find the "white bites" (I have no idea what flavor they are) while Scooter has this really silly game of taking one piece at a time, running to the LR to eat it and then going back for another piece. It takes him hours to eat one meal.

Since Max has lost most of his teeth, we have added more of the soft, burger looking food. We call it "sprinkles" and you haven't seen excitement until you see him doing his lil sprinkle dance when he hears the cellophane wrapper.

We have tried most of the expensive, "healthier" foods and well, our dogs just don't like them. Taste of the Wild, Science Diet, Royal Canin... might as well been Alpo. Gravy Train is one of their favs, but with schnauzer beards, it was nixed pretty quickly because they LOVE to use the back of Jess' pants legs to wipe their beards! LOL

If you really wanna know the secret, Jess is probably a better authority. We lost our black lab, Shelby, just a year ago, and she was 19. Jess knows how to grow 'em old!

Kiba turned 2 in August. His mom is an American Pit Bull Terrier (Old Family Red Nose) and his dad is assumed to be some other sort of terrier, probably schnauzer, because Kiba has a beard. A gray one. Between his beard and his laid back disposition, people assume he's an old man.





We spotted him at an adoption drive when he was 6 months old. He wasn't allowed inside the building with the other dogs because he is a bullie mix.

He was sitting quietly, watching everyone. Took 2 weeks from that day til he got to come home, due to the rescue organization's very good, intense adoption process. She had pics of his mom & his 11 litter-mates at their first home; mom was chained outside, skin & bones. The rescue woman talked the owner into giving her all of them.

i tried desperately to get my house mate to adopt his mom, but she put her foot down at one.

Kiba is the easiest dog to train i've ever had (i grew up with dogs, he's my first Bullie). i love him dearly.
